The Thought Chain
The Thought Chain begins with a thought that leads to feelings. If
the mind thinks of a happy thought, we feel happy. In the Thought
Chain, therefore, feelings follow thought. Some people however
question this. In their view, while a happy thought may lead to a
happy feeling, they believe that a happy feeling creates a happy
thought, and hence, feelings don't follow a thought, but precede it.
15
The Thought Chain
-
While their argument is correct, a simple logic puts thoughts before
feelings in the Thought Chain. This logic pertains to the nature of
thoughts, that is, if there were no thoughts in the mind, there would
be no feelings. Thus, all feelings are created by the electrical
vibrations produced by thoughts. Science has also shown that
failure in the functioning of the mind directly results in the absence
of the corresponding feelings. Thus, while feelings do influence
thoughts, the rightful link in the Thought Chain is that of thoughts
preceding feelings.

What is NEP?
NEP is an acronym for Negative Energy Poison. Just as
positive energy creates power, negative energy creates poison.
How does negative energy create NEP? It paralyzes thought; it
creates hesitation, fear, worry, anger, hate, jealousy, greed, sorrow,
pessimism and doubt amongst other things. All these lead one to
respond negatively. They create an environment of negativity
giving rise to negative thoughts, feelings and actions. NEP or
negative energy poison can never result in any positive action.
We don't realize it, but at times, when we don't fill our life with PEP,
poisonous negative energies enter our life without our knowledge
and lead us to failure and disaster. These negative energies build
negative habits, brick by brick. They capture the mind and take
charge of the thought factory. Cumulatively, they become so
poisonous that they can destroy life. Hence, I call them NEP
Negative Energy Poison.
